NYU’s Aswath Damodaran warns that while U.S. stocks appear richly valued, timing a correction is risky. He highlights rising valuations, driven by major tech stocks, and offers five strategies for investors. Damodaran stresses that even when markets look overpriced, predicting corrections is highly uncertain and requires careful planning.
Tamilnad Mercantile Bank Q1 profit jumps 35% on strong income growth
Tamilnad Mercantile Bank reported a 35% year-on-year rise in June quarter net profit to Rs 412 crore, driven by higher income and net interest income.
